Night shift: evacuation-chair store on Stairwell C, Level 3, was restocked today. Two Havermont chairs serviced, one sent to Drayle Safety for repair. Check the seal on the store door at 02:00 rounds. If the seal is broken, log it and re-secure. Door access for the store uses the pass below.

staff pass of fajop-kajop = bdg-H-83

## TilePrime Prefetcher — On-call Notes

TilePrime prefetches map tiles for the Corvane delivery app ahead of peak hours. It authenticates to the internal TileVault service with a single API key; if prefetch jobs fail with 403s, the key has likely expired. Rotation is handled quarterly by the platform team. The current staging key is shown below.

service key, tadup-tahog: zpat7_wB1tnEL

## Service Accounts — Bouncemill

Bouncemill (the email bounce processor) runs under the `svc-bouncemill` account. It consumes the Postfern bounce queue, classifies hard/soft bounces, and writes verdicts to Mailbook. Scope: read queue, write verdicts, nothing else. Rotation cadence: quarterly, owned by the Delivery pod. For the sync demo, the current Postfern queue key is below.

gateway credential: kto3_qfe

### Key Ceremony Checklist — Item 7: Firmware Channel Escrow

Before sealing the Larkspur update channel for the Ontiva device fleet, the support team must verify that both signing officers have confirmed the channel manifest hash aloud and that the witness has initialed the ceremony log. Place the hardware token in the tamper-evident bag, record the bag serial in the log, and confirm the escrow envelope is present. The escrow envelope must contain the recovery passphrase printed directly below this item.

vault phrase of tajef-tafog = istox-sorax-zorox-casok-holox-kelix-weneth-drueth-casion

## Configuration

The Ledgerfold converter accumulates sub-cent remainders per currency pair and settles them nightly, so rounding drift stays bounded. Configure it via .env: ROUNDING_MODE should be banker for all environments, SETTLE_HOUR is 02 UTC, and DRIFT_ALERT_BPS defaults to 3. Changing ROUNDING_MODE mid-cycle corrupts the remainder ledger, so coordinate with the on-call first. Immediately below the DRIFT_ALERT_BPS entry, place the settlement API secret.

sealed setting: ARCHIVE_KEY3=8d0